1957 Austin A 40 vs. 2007 Ford E-150

To start off, 2007 Ford E-150 is newer by 50 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1957 Austin A 40.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1957 Austin A 40 would be higher. At 4,606 cc (8 cylinders), 2007 Ford E-150 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Ford E-150 (225 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 176 more horse power than 1957 Austin A 40. (49 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Ford E-150 should accelerate faster than 1957 Austin A 40.

Let's talk about torque, 2007 Ford E-150 (389 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 289 more torque (in Nm) than 1957 Austin A 40. (100 Nm @ 2100 RPM). This means 2007 Ford E-150 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1957 Austin A 40. 2007 Ford E-150 has automatic transmission and 1957 Austin A 40 has manual transmission. 1957 Austin A 40 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2007 Ford E-150 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1957 Austin A 40 2007 Ford E-150
Make Austin Ford
Model A 40 E-150
Year Released 1957 2007
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1489 cc 4606 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 49 HP 225 HP
Engine RPM 4400 RPM 4800 RPM
Torque 100 Nm 389 Nm
Torque RPM 2100 RPM 3500 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Length 4130 mm 5390 mm
Vehicle Width 1570 mm 2020 mm
Vehicle Height 1570 mm 2060 mm
Wheelbase Size 2530 mm 3510 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 72 L 132 L
